Muller puts forward plans for 133 Cheshire homes
The developer has submitted an environmental impact assessment screening report to Cheshire East Council, scoping out the potential to build a residential scheme on the land west of Moorsfield Avenue in Audlem.
Plans propose building 133 homes, 30% of which would be affordable, on a 23-acre plot. The EIA application will consider the environmental effects of such a scheme.
Access, parking, and public open space would be included, and the site would act as an extension to the village of Audlem, on land currently used for agricultural purposes.
The EIA has been prepared by Barry’s on behalf of Muller Property Group, a prevalent housebuilder in Cheshire with schemes underway at Maylands Park, and which recently sold a 20-acre Sandbach plot to Anwyl Homes.
An opinion on the EIA will be expected within three weeks of this application’s submission.
